All-natural Alternatives to Antidepressants
Natural choices to antidepressants have increased in popularity over the past decade in the United States and worldwide. These remedies include St. John's wort, S-adenosyl methionine and omega-3 fats (eicosapentaenoic acid and docosahexaenoic acid).


These supplements function in a different way than prescription antidepressants by modifying neurotransmitter degrees in the mind. Ask your doctor for more information.

St. John's Wort
St John's Wort is a plant that is typically absorbed capsule type and as a tea. It is thought to treat clinical depression by altering the manner in which certain chemical messengers in the mind job. It has been revealed to be reliable in treating mild depression, and research study recommends that it may be just as excellent as standard antidepressants.

Nevertheless, a current large research study located that St John's wort was no more effective than a sugar pill in the therapy of moderate to serious clinical depression. The study was well made and satisfied all the criteria of a good randomized regulated test. The researchers did not reveal any kind of economic rate of interests in the research study.

While St John's wort can be bought in many health food stores and drug stores without a prescription, it is best to speak with a physician initially. This is because the herb can engage with numerous sorts of medications, including some cancer treatments. It can likewise trigger some individuals to experience withdrawal signs and symptoms if they suddenly stop taking it.

SAMe
SAMe (s-adenosyl methionine) is a naturally occurring compound in the body that plays a role in lots of organic features. It has actually been revealed to boost depression in some studies, although more research study is required to confirm these outcomes.

In one study, SAMe improved anxiety in older grownups greater than a sugar pill and had a much faster onset of action than a low dose of a TCA (tricyclic antidepressant). Nevertheless, some people might have a damaging response to this supplement. It can cause stomach upset, dizziness, and agitation. Additionally, it can disrupt specific medicines, consisting of blood slimmers and contraceptive pill.

Extra study is additionally required to recognize the lasting results of SAMe. It is not suggested for individuals with bipolar disorder due to the fact that it might get worse signs and symptoms of mania. Speak to your physician before taking this or any other dietary supplements for depression. They can help you choose safe and reliable all-natural treatments for your anxiety.

Omega-3 fatty acids
The omega-3 fatty acids e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) and doc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) are crucial for the normal functioning of our immune, inflammatory, cardiovascular, and nervous systems. They also appear to prevent depression and rise state of mind.

In a current scientific test, people that were taking an antidepressant with a high dosage of omega-3 fatty acids experienced improved HAM-D scores contrasted to the sugar pill group. The authors recommended that the omega-3 fats act to modify natural chemical signaling and hinder secretion of proinflammatory cytokines, therefore wetting the mood-altering results of norepinephrine and cortisol.

Although a number of research studies show that all-natural drugs can minimize some of the symptoms of clinical depression, even more research study is needed to figure out whether these treatments are safe and reliable choices or accessories to prescription antidepressants. Additionally, many of these therapies can connect with particular medicines and are not recommended for expectant ladies. Generally, individuals must take these supplements under the supervision of a doctor.

5-HTP
5-HTP is the intermediate metabolite of the amino acid tryptophan. It's the foundation of serotonin, and the body converts dietary tryptophan to 5-HTP and afterwards to serotonin both centrally and peripherally.

Research studies of 5-HTP's effectiveness are combined, however it does seem to aid how to choose a therapist anxiety in some people. It additionally might alleviate fibromyalgia signs and symptoms and hot flashes in ladies with menopause. It's unclear whether it aids with fat burning, sleeplessness or migraines.

It's important to seek advice from a physician before taking 5-HTP. It can boost serotonin levels and connect with a number of drugs, consisting of antidepressants. It's also not suggested for use if you're having a carcinoid lump urine test to monitor cancer cells or are being treated for a cancer cells with a serotonin-affecting drug. On top of that, integrating it with other supplements that raise serotonin may bring about serotonin syndrome. These consist of kava, melatonin and hops.
